agree to have the same opinion or feel the same way.
bicycle a light vehicle with two wheels, one behind the other. You make the wheels turn by pushing on pedals.
closet a small room or space for storing things such as clothes or supplies.
court a place where legal matters are heard.
household the group of people, such as a family, that lives together in one place.
invite to ask in a polite way to go somewhere or do something.
meat the flesh of animals when used as food.
owe to have to pay; be in debt to someone.
pant to breathe in quick, short breaths; gasp.
partner someone who owns and runs a business with another person.
phone a short form of telephone.
roam to move or travel around without a plan; wander.
shower a period of rain that lasts a short time.
square a flat, closed figure with four straight sides of equal length and four equal corners.
throw to send something through the air using your arm.
